我最近将一个简单的Java EE 6项目迁移到了Java EE 7。具体来说,这意味着我刚刚将依赖项从javax:javaee-api:6.0更改为javax:javaee-api:7.0,并将其部署到Glassfish 4而不是Glassfish 3。
之后,该应用程序不再工作,因为CDI无法注入注释的依赖项。
我正在尝试检测用户正在查看的长方体几何图形的哪面墙。假设用户在一个房间里,我想要检测摄像头当前正在看的是哪面墙。我是这样从摄像机投射光线的:
var lookAtVector = new THREE.Vector3(0,0, -1);
lookAtVector.applyQuaternion(camera.quaternion);
raycaster.setFromCamera(lookAtVector, camera);
var intersection = raycaster.intersectObject(box);
cons
我刚刚将焊接版从2.4.4升级到3.0.1。在应用程序启动时,我面临以下错误,无法找到解决方案。我用的是焊接SE。
Sep 15, 2017 1:25:12 PM org.jboss.weld.xml.BeansXmlHandler error
WARN: WELD-001208: Error when validating file:/(...)/META-INF/beans.xml@7 against xsd. cvc-complex-type.2.4.a: Invalid content was found starting with element 'weld:scan'